数据库完整性 一. 概述 1. 定义 数据库完整性是指 DBMS 应保证的 DB 的一种特性,即在任何情况下的正确性,有效性,一致性。 广义完整性:语义完整性,并发控制,安全控制,DB 故障恢复等狭义完整性:专指语义完整性,DBMS 通常有专门的完整性管理机制与程序来处理语义完整性的问题 2. 关系模
Linux下载neo4j 直接在服务器上使用命令下载: curl -O http://dist.neo4j.org/neo4j-community-3.4.5-unix.tar.gz 安装Neo4j 解压安装: tar -axvf neo4j-community-3.4.5-unix.tar.gz 配置初始Neo4j 在安装目录下找到conf目录下的neo4j.conf文件,修改相应配置如下: # 修改第22行load
select fun_encrypt_app('123','5j3EAa7qp/R8xLquBKQskSaAtp224McC') from dual; select fun_decrypt_app('EoeGAnAg51Y','5j3EAa7qp/R8xLquBKQskSaAtp224McC') from dual; 加密部分: CREATE OR REPLACE FUNCTION fun_encrypt_app(
1 --[预定义异常] 2 declare 3 4 v_sal employees.salary%type; 5 begin 6 select salary into v_sal 7 from employees 8 where employee_id >100; 9 10 dbms_output.put_line(v_sal); 11 12 exception 13 when Too_many_rows then dbm
1 ----------------------------------------------------- 2 条件判断 3 ----------------------------------------------------- 4 7. 使用 IF ... THEN ... ELSIF ... THEN ...ELSE ... END IF; 5 6 要求: 查询出 150号 员工的工资, 若其工资大于或
本篇主要内容如下: 6.1 引言 6.2 创建函数 6.3 存储过程 6.3.1 创建过程 6.3.2 调用存储过程 6.3.3 AUTHID 6.3.4 PRAGMA AUTONOMOUS_TRANSACTION 6.3.5 开发存储过程步骤 6.3.6 删除过程和函数 6.3.7 过程与函数的比较 6.1 引言 过程与函数(另外还有包与触发
(1)数据项,字段,属性一般指表中一列,记录指代表中一行 (2)数据库:数据库就是相互之间有关联关系的table的集合 (3)数据库系统:数据库+数据库管理系统+数据库应用+数据库管理员+计算机基本系统 (4)SQL=DDL+DML+DCL(使用者通过数据库语言利用DBMS操作数据库) (5)数据库语言与高级语言:一条数据库
Deferred statistics publish,延迟统计信息发布,将新生成的统计信息存放到一块临时的区域,供充分测试以验证统计信息对执行计划确有促进作用的情况下,再发布到数据字典供全局session使用,规避了因收集方法不当等原因引起统计信息不准确从而导致optimizer选择次优plan的问题 ---创建测试
--启用sys审计 alter system set audit_sys_operations='TRUE' --启用db审计 alter system set audit_trail='DB_EXTENDED' scope=spfile ; --迁移aud$表到用户自定义表空间 BEGIN DBMS_AUDIT_MGMT.set_audit_trail_location( audit_trail_type => DBMS_AUDIT_MGMT.AUD
具有一定关系的数据构成表(Table),具有一定关系的表就构成了数据库(DB)。 抽象化学习数据库的五大基本部分如下: 以图书管理系统为例实例化如下: 下面从两个角度理解数据库管理系统(DBMS): (1)从用户的角度看,数据库管理系统(DBMS)应该具备的功能有:数据库定义(创建数据库),操作(增删改数
此文转载自:https://blog.csdn.net/weixin_51614581/article/details/113184109 数据库 1 数据厍基本概述1.1 基本组成1.2 数据库管理系统(DBMS)1.2 数据库系统 2 数据库系统发展史2.1 第三代数据库2.2 当今主流数据库 3 关系数据库3.2 基本概述3.2 存储结构 4 mysql数据库
目录 数据库的优势 数据库的相关概念 数据库存储数据的特点 初始mysql mysql软件介绍 mysql产品安装 mysql服务的启动和停止 mysql服务的登录退出 mysql的常用命令 mysql的语法规范 数据库的优势 实现数据持久化保存 结构化查询,使用完整的管理系统统一管理,易于查询 数据库
Oracle第九课 一、in,exists的用法 in:在一个范围内 select * from emp where empno in (select empno from emp where deptno=10)-- 编号和姓名重复delete from emp where empno not in (select min(empno) from emp group by empno,ename)) exists比in效率高 主子表的存在
处理对象类型 SCHEMA_EXPORT/TABLE/TRIGGERORA-39127: 调用 export_string :=EXFSYS.DBMS_EXPFIL_DEPASEXP.SCHEMA_INFO_EXP('ECOLOGY8',1,1,'11.02.00.04.00',newblock) 时发生意外错误ORA-04063: package body "EXFSYS.DBMS_EXPFIL_EXP" 有错误ORA-06508: PL/SQ
set serveroutput on; --最简单的语句块 begin dbms_output.put_line('HelloWorld'); end; / --语句块的组成 declare v_num number := 0; begin v_num := 2/v_num; dbms_output.put_line(v_num); exception when others then dbms_o
数据库系统(Database system)= 数据库管理系统(DBMS,Database Management System)+数据库(Database) 数据库管理系统(DBMS)可分为两类:一类为基于共享文件系统的DBMS,另一类为基于客户机-服务器的DBMS。 前者包括Microsoft Access 和FileMaker等,用于桌面用途,通常不用于高端或更关键的应用。
ORACLE_OCP之Oracle Scheduler( ORACLE调度器)自动执行任务 文章目标: 使用Oracle Scheduler简化管理任务创建作业,计划和调度日程监视作业执行使用基于时间或基于事件的计划来执行Oracle Scheduler作业描述窗口,窗口组,作业类别和消费组的使用使用电子邮件通知使用工作链执行一
第十八课 使用视图 一、视图 #视图是虚拟的表。 #与包含数据的表不一样,视图只包含使用时动态检索数据的查询 #MySQL从版本5开始支持视图,较早版本不适用 【1】SELECT cust_name, cust_contact FROM customers, orders, orderitems WHERE customers.cust_id = orders.cust_id
在使用PL/SQL的时候,我们有时候会向sqlplus输出一些结果,但是可能会出现没有结果出现的情况 原因:环境变量serveroutput是关闭状态,默认不会打印输出 set serveroutput on 使用set serveroutput on 命令设置环境变量serveroutput为打开状态,从而使得pl/sql程序能够在sqlplus中输
虽然知道dbms_resource_manager可以限制CPU的使用率,但也一直未真正使用过。今天有个需求,需要限制数据库某一个或几个用户的CPU最大使用率,于是有了如下测试。 1. 在数据库中创建MAINTENANCE资源消费组begindbms_resource_manager.create_pending_area(); dbms_resource_manager.cre
1.DB DBMS SQL DB:数据库 DBMS:数据库管理系统:数据库是通过DBMS创建和操作的容器 例如:MySQL oracle DB2 SQLserver SQL:结构化查询语言:用来操作DBMS 2.数据库的特点 2.1 先将数据放到表中,在将表放到库中 2.2 一个数据库可以有多个表,每个表都只有一个名字,用来
背景: 项目有个前端功能实现依赖于后台数据库定时触发某项任务。 测试环境准备创建此项数据库任务,以满足前端的测试。 参考: https://www.cnblogs.com/linjiqin/p/3152638.html https://www.cnblogs.com/yscit/p/10376005.html Oralce中的任务有2种:Job和Dbms_job,两者的区别有:
/* Formatted on 2020/11/13 11:38:36 (QP5 v5.326) */ DECLARE /*以下定义开始日期,每次查询时请自行修改*/ startdate CHAR (10) := '2020-10-01'; /* 以下语句请切记不要改动!!!!!!!!!!!!!!!!!! */ v_dap_finindex dap_finindex%ROWTYPE; v
1、游标的概念 游标(CURSOR):游标是把从数据表中提取出来的数据,以临时表的形式存放在内存中,在游标中有一个数据指针,在初始状态下指向的是首记录,利用fetch语句可以移动该指针,从而对游标中的数据进行各种操作。 2、游标的作用 游标是用来处理使用SELECT语句从数据库中检索到的多行记录
数据库介绍 数据库概述 数据库优点: 可以将数据永久存入磁盘可以存储大量数据方便检索 数据库相关概念 DB 数据库(database):存储数据的仓库,它保存了一系列有组织的数据。DBMS 数据库管理系统(Database Management System):数据库是通过DBMS创建和操作的容器SQL 结构化查询语言(